Title: The Innovative Journey of Jing Qing
Introduction
Jing Qing is a prominent inventor based in San Francisco, CA. She has made significant contributions to the field of biotechnology, particularly in the development of antibodies. With a total of 8 patents to her name, her work has had a substantial impact on medical research and treatment.
Latest Patents
Among her latest innovations are the patents for Anti-FGFR3 antibodies and methods using the same. These inventions provide FGFR3 antibodies, compositions comprising these antibodies, and methods for utilizing them effectively. Her work in this area showcases her commitment to advancing therapeutic options for various medical conditions.
Career Highlights
Jing has worked with notable companies in the biotechnology sector, including Genentech, Inc. and F. Hoffmann-La Roche AG. Her experience in these leading organizations has allowed her to refine her skills and contribute to groundbreaking research and development projects.
Collaborations
Throughout her career, Jing has collaborated with esteemed colleagues such as Avi J Ashkenazi and Christian Wiesmann. These partnerships have fostered an environment of innovation and have led to the successful development of her patented technologies.
